A heartwarming middle-grade adventure about the bond between two brothers, their faithful horse, and a surprising legacy. A deserving follow-up to I Am Rebel from a beloved author twice short-listed for the Costa Children's Book Award

Remember everything I taught you, Small Wonder. Take care of Leaf. Take care of Pebble. I've done all I can. The rest is up to you . . .

Tick, called Small Wonder by his grandfather, lives peacefully at the edge of Ellia, along with his little brother and faithful horse. But then a deadly assassin arrives. Enemies are invading and the kingdom is in danger. Tick has six moons to get to Kings' Keep and warn their ruler. Traveling through forests and over mountains, encountering bandits and rogue knights, Tick is determined to honor his grandfather's last words of advice . . . Make it count.

Author Bio: Ross Montgomery

Author Bio: Ross Montgomery

Ross Montgomery is the author of The Murder at World's End, his first novel for adults. He is the author of several award-winning books for children. His novels have been twice shortlisted for the Costa Children’s Book of the Year and twice selected for the Waterstones' Children’s Book of the Month, as well as chosen for the London Sunday Times’ Top 100 Modern Children’s Classics. I Am Rebel was a Barnes&Noble pick of the month and was chosen by Waterstones as their Children's Book of the Year 2024.
